Jacquelyn Jones Obituary

Mrs. Jacquelyn Darnell Jones (Jackie) went to be with the Lord on September 13, 2010.
Jackie was born in Stokesdale, North Carolina on May 12, 1928. She attended schools in Stokesdale and graduated in 1946. Jackie moved to Georgia in 1946 as a result of her marriage to Waldo Jones. Mr. Jones was a police officer and they lived in several small towns throughout South Georgia. Jackie raised four children during her lifetime. She retired from Cooper Wiss in 1991. After her retirement she enjoyed traveling, with the Great Smokey Mountains being her favorite spot. Jackie enjoyed spending time with her children, grandchildren and great grandchildren. Jackie had many friends that made her life very happy. She was a member of the Trinity Baptist Church.
Jackie was preceded in death by her grandmother Sallie Jane Boles; her parents Elmer and China Alice Darnell of Stokesdale, North Carolina; husband Waldo Jones; sister and brother-in-law Inez and Howard Angel; sister and brother-in-law Cardine and Paul Vernon; brother and sister-in-law Lonnie and Grace Darnell, all of Greensboro; brother-in-law Russell Gray of Colfax, N.C.; four nephews, David Gray, Dudley Vernon, and James and Billy Angel. Also, a very special daughter-in-law, Sandy King Jones.
